After taking a 1-0 lead midway through the first half, Paris Saint-Germain was at the mercy of OGC Nice, who tied the match at one and generated a few scoring chances that would’ve given them the lead.
However, the capital club was able to withstand Nice’s best punch, and eventually, their talent broke through. Kylian Mbappé provided the cross with Mauro Icardi having the gentle touch to lobby it to Moise Kean, who finished the play by scoring PSG’s second goal.
